A miniatures rule set for recreating Napoleonic battles. Supplemental rules also provide for recreating Seven Years War battles. Units are infantry battalions, cavalry regiments and artillery batteries. Infantry units with flank and rear support receive benefits in melee, which encourages Napoleonic linear tactics. The Sharp End is a tactical level simulation of conflict between modern regular and irregular forces using miniatures. It can simulate a vast array of conflicts including Northern Ireland, Iraq, Chechnya, Embassy sieges, Afghanistan and others. Refighting History is a series of wargame books by Charles S Grant. In this series Charles describes historical actions, provides the detail of the forces involved and the preparation to bring the actions to the wargame table.
